By Zoran Lazarevic

The evolution of 4G into 5G has the potential to be a powerful economic growth engine, particularly as this advanced mobile technology is deployed looking into improving productivity in key vertical industrial sectors.

Regulators across the Gulf countries have done an excellent job in supporting Communication Service Providers (CSPs) with an efficient spectrum allocations process for 5G deployments.

As a result of regulators’ work on 5G spectrum allocations, some of the first 5G deployments globally were executed by CSPs in the Gulf countries and these CSPs are now global leaders in 5G deployments.

One year after the first 5G deployments, regulators in the Gulf countries are now starting the benchmarking of 5G coverage, to ensure that CSPs are meeting conditions for spectrum allocations. However, there are challenges in terms of how measurements are done. The methodology that is typically used for the benchmark measurements in 2G/3G/4G networks might not be suitable for 5G networks and might not provide accurate benchmark results.

So the question remains, what measurements can be used for benchmarking of the 5G networks?

The answer to this question is not simple as it is not possible to conduct signal strength measurements in idle mode in the same way it was done for 2G/3G/4G networks.

The preferred way for 5G networks benchmark measurements is to conduct the end-user performance driven benchmark measurements. These benchmark measurements should be based on the throughput as the main performance indicator that defines end-user experiences when using network services.

We conducted several benchmark measurements between 5G networks with different configurations for common channel and the results demonstrate that it is not accurate to compare 5G networks based on the common channel measurements. The benchmarking results presented the following insights:

  1. Benchmark measurements in Gulf Country A: Measurements are conducted for the two CSPs that use different configurations for the common channel in idle mode. CSP “A1” has a control channel configuration with beam sweeping while CSP “A2” has a control channel configuration with a wide beam.
  2. Benchmark measurements in Gulf Country B: Similarly to the first example, the two CSPs have different configurations for the common channels in idle mode. Again, it can be seen that CSP that typically has lower signal strength as well as lower signal to interference ratio, CSP “B2”, has a better downlink and uplink throughput.

The throughput measurements are more complex to conduct then signal strength based measurement and the network traffic level at the time of measurement has an impact on the measurements.

However, the throughput measurements will present an accurate snapshot of the real end-user experiences at the time of the measurement. If one needs to use the signal strength measurements for 5G networks benchmarking, then measurements need to be normalized to reflect different configurations for control channels.

There is no perfect solution to the current needs to conduct an objective 5G networks benchmark measurement with similar simplicity and efficiency as it was done for the previous generation of mobile networks.

However, the preferred way to conduct benchmark measurements is end-user performance driven measurements. The downlink and uplink throughput based measurements will reflect actual end-user experiences in the measured network.

The industry may need to come up with an alignment on how the signal strength measurements can be conducted for 5G networks in a meaningful way. Ericsson is recognizing an industry-wide challenge related to the methodology for 5G benchmark measurement and is currently working on a document for the 5G measurement methodology that will be made public in the near future.

Quest Merchant Bank has been appointed as Transaction Advisor for Project BRIDGE, a broadband infrastructure initiative of the Federal Ministry of Communications, Innovation and Digital Economy (FMCIDE), led by Bosun Tijani, the minister.

FG Taps Quest Merchant Bank for Advisory on 90,000km Fibre Project

Project BRIDGE, short for Broadband Infrastructure Development for Digital Economy, is designed to deepen Nigeria’s digital backbone through the deployment of about 90,000 kilometres of open-access fibre-optic cables nationwide.

The initiative is expected to boost broadband penetration, strengthen connectivity and drive inclusive economic growth.

Under the mandate, Quest Merchant Bank will work with the ministry and the Project Implementation Unit to structure the project’s financial and commercial framework.

This includes developing bankable investment models, engaging investors and designing a public-private partnership structure to ensure efficient execution and sustainability.

Afolabi Olorode, acting managing director, described the project as a critical intervention for Nigeria’s digital economy.

“Project BRIDGE represents a critical step in strengthening Nigeria’s digital backbone and unlocking the immense opportunities within the country’s digital economy. We are honoured to partner with the FMCIDE under the leadership of Honourable Minister, Dr Bosun Tijani on this important initiative,” he said.

He added that the bank would leverage its expertise in infrastructure finance to develop “a robust and investable framework that will attract private capital and support long-term national development.”

Also speaking, Yetunde Falore, head of Investment Banking at Quest Merchant Bank, said the project comes at a defining moment for Nigeria’s digital economy.

“Nigeria’s digital economy is entering a defining phase, and infrastructure initiatives such as Project BRIDGE will play a central role in expanding connectivity, deepening digital inclusion, and supporting sustainable economic growth,” she stated.

Falore noted that the bank would focus on ensuring the timely and efficient delivery of the project in its advisory role.

The initiative aligns with the Renewed Hope agenda of President Bola Ahmed Tinubu, which prioritises digital infrastructure expansion and private sector participation in critical national assets.

Kenya’s High Court has ruled that mobile phone numbers are not disposable assets, but constitutionally protected digital identifiers, striking at the core of a long-standing industry practice of arbitrarily reassigning inactive SIM cards without the owners’ consent.

Court Bans Kenyan Telcos from Recycling SIM Cards

In a landmark decision that could reshape telecom regulation and digital identity frameworks across Africa, sitting at Milimani Law Courts in Nairobi, Justice Lawrence Mugambi declared that reassigning a phone number without the original owner’s consent violates the right to privacy.

The ruling effectively elevates a SIM card into the same legal category as personal data tied to an individual’s private life.

At the heart of the ruling is Article 31 of the Constitution, which safeguards citizens from unnecessary disclosure of private information and interference with communications.

The court found that in today’s digital economy, a registered mobile number functions as a critical gateway to sensitive personal data, linking users to mobile money platforms like M-PESA, banking systems, email accounts, and social media profiles.

“When mobile digital identity is lost through reallocation or recycling without interrogating the reasons behind inactivity, it creates an avenue for unauthorised disclosure of delicate information,” the judgment stated.

The case, brought by Erastus Ngura Odhiambo, petitioner and former prisoner, challenged the routine telecoms practice of deactivating SIM cards after prolonged inactivity and reassigning them to new users.

Odhiambo lost access to his mobile phone number due to inactivity while serving his lengthy sentence.

He argued that the practice exposes individuals to serious risks, including misdirected financial transactions, intercepted one-time passwords, and unintended access to private communications.

The court agreed, highlighting how recycled numbers can result in strangers receiving confidential messages, authentication codes, and even being added to private messaging groups, effectively inheriting fragments of another person’s digital life.

Justice Mugambi also criticised the rigidity of SIM deactivation policies, calling them “arbitrary” for failing to consider legitimate reasons for inactivity such as incarceration, studying in restricted environments, or living abroad.

“Incarceration does not strip an individual of their constitutional rights to privacy and identity,” he noted.

For telecom operators, including Safaricom, the ruling introduces a significant compliance burden. The court outlined three strict conditions before any number can be reassigned.

Telcos must obtain informed and verifiable consent from the original owner, issue a public notice and conduct traceability efforts over a reasonable period.

More importantly, the court further directed that telecoms firms must implement technical safeguards to prevent data exposure to the new user.

The Office of the Attorney General has been given six months to translate these directives into enforceable regulations.

Binance Earn offers cryptocurrency users an accessible way to generate rewards on idle digital assets without active trading or constant market monitoring.

Binance Earn: Simple Way to Earn Rewards on Idle Crypto Holdings

Binance Earn

As the crypto market matures, more holders seek productive uses for their assets rather than leaving them dormant in wallets. Binance addresses this through Binance Earn, where users allocate supported cryptocurrencies to various reward products for automatic yield generation.

The platform emphasises simplicity with a “set-and-forget” model: users select assets, pick a product, and rewards accrue passively in the background. This appeals especially to long-term holders aiming to enhance portfolio value over time without day-to-day involvement.

Binance Earn provides flexible options for instant liquidity access alongside fixed-term products for defined commitments, catering to diverse strategies and risk appetites.

“We’re seeing growing interest across Africa in ways to make crypto holdings more productive without active trading,” said Larry Cooke, Africa Head of Legal at Binance. “Simple, ‘set-and-forget’ solutions are becoming increasingly relevant as more users take a longer-term approach to digital assets.”

The feature reflects shifting user behaviour towards holding and gradual growth amid volatile markets, where reward rates fluctuate based on conditions, liquidity, and structures.

Users must assess risks and alignment with personal goals, as crypto remains volatile. Binance Earn positions itself as a key tool in Africa’s rising digital asset adoption, enabling hands-off participation in the ecosystem.
